Technical features of the Lastochka on-board network
The organization of a wireless network in long-distance trains and high-speed commuter trains is based on the use of technology LTE-4G/5GThe signal from cell phone towers is captured by antennas located on the roof of the locomotive or train cars. The resulting signal is converted by a router and distributed inside the cabin via access points. Wi-FiThe main provider providing this service is the company MT_Free, which uses equipment from various vendors to provide coverage along railway lines.
The network architecture is designed to minimize data packet loss at high train speeds. Special handover algorithms are used to achieve this, switching connections between base stations without interrupting the user's session. However, the physics of the process dictates its own limitations: in densely populated areas, forested areas, or mountainous terrain, the signal may weaken, resulting in reduced channel throughput.
⚠️ Please note: The equipment in the cars may vary depending on the year of manufacture of the train and the region of operation. Older trains may use less powerful routers that do not support the standard. 802.11ac.
Traffic segmentation is an important aspect. The passenger segment is separated from the service segment, which is used by conductors and train diagnostic systems. This ensures data security and the stability of critical systems. For the user, this means connecting to an isolated network, with access to internal resources limited only by the internet gateway.
Why does the speed drop when the carriage is full?
The bandwidth is divided among all active users. If there are 100 people in a train car, and 80 of them are watching video, the speed per user will drop to a minimum, even if the 4G signal is excellent.
Step-by-step connection instructions for Android and iOS
The authorization process on devices running operating systems Android And iOS Captive portals have their own peculiarities related to security policies and browser operating mechanisms. In most cases, the system will automatically prompt you to go to the authorization page immediately after connecting to the access point. If this doesn't happen, you'll need to perform a series of manual steps to launch the captive portal.
For users iPhone And iPad The algorithm is as follows: after selecting a network from the list of available connections, the device may display a warning that the network does not have internet access. You must confirm your wish to continue using it. The login window will then open automatically. If the browser doesn't launch, try opening any website using the HTTP protocol, for example, neverssl.com, which forcibly initiates a redirect to the provider's portal.
For owners of smartphones based on Android You should pay more attention to notifications. The operating system often blocks access to the login page in the background to save data. In this case, you need to:
- 📱 Open your browser and go to any unsecured website.
- 🔍 Check your notifications in the notification bar—there might be a request to log in.
- ⚙️ In the Wi-Fi settings, click the gear icon next to the network name and select "Manage" or "View login page."
- 🔄 If nothing helps, temporarily disable mobile data in settings to prevent your phone from trying to use 4G instead of Wi-Fi.

Working with laptops and tablets on Windows and macOS
Connecting stationary devices such as laptops Windows or macOS, requires more careful attention to network adapter settings. Often, the problem lies with the static IP address previously assigned to the home or office network. For proper operation on public transport, addressing must be performed automatically via the protocol. DHCP.
In the Windows operating system, check the protocol settings IPv4To do this, go to Control Panel → Network and Internet → Network and Sharing Center, select your wireless connection and click "Properties". In the list of components, find Internet Protocol version 4 (TCP/IPv4) Make sure the options to obtain an IP address and DNS server automatically are checked. Any manual settings may block access to your provider's gateway.
On devices Mac The situation is similar, but the settings interface is different. Go to System Preferences → Network, select Wi-Fi and click "Advanced". In the TCP/IP tab, make sure the IPv4 configuration method is set to Use DHCPIf you use third-party antiviruses or firewalls, temporarily disable their network protection, as they may block redirection to the authorization portal.

Tariff plans and speed limits
Provider MT_Free offers a flexible pricing system that allows passengers to choose the best internet plan based on their needs. Basic access is typically free with speed and data limits, suitable for messaging and text browsing. Paid options are available for more demanding tasks, such as video streaming or file downloading.
There are several main types of packages available on the road. Free plan Often limits the speed to 64-128 kbps, making it impossible to watch HD video, but sufficient for email. Paid plans can provide unlimited access for a specific time (e.g., 1 hour, 4 hours, or all day) with increased speeds of up to 10-20 Mbps.
Payment for plans can be made via SMS, bank card, or mobile phone balance. Always read the terms and conditions carefully before sending a paid SMS or entering your card details.
Solving common connection problems
Despite the system's robustness, users may encounter technical glitches. One of the most common issues is the device becoming stuck on an access point without actually accessing the network. This occurs when the router in the train car is overloaded or the controller malfunctions. In this case, the best solution is to completely forget the network in the Wi-Fi settings and reconnect after a few minutes.
Another common issue is the login page loading endlessly. This is often due to DNS cache or ad blockers. Try opening the login page in incognito mode or temporarily disabling browser extensions, such as AdBlock or uBlock Origin, which may interfere with the operation of portal scripts.
⚠️ Warning: If you see a network with a name similar to the official one but with extra characters or a different one by one letter, do not connect to it. It may be an attacker trying to intercept your data.
It's also worth mentioning the session timeout issue. The connection may be lost if it's idle for a long period of time. To regain access, you don't need to re-enter the code—often, simply refreshing the page of any website is enough, and the system will redirect you to the confirmation page without resending the SMS.
Connection optimization and expert advice
For those who critically need a stable internet connection while traveling, there are a number of technical tricks to improve connection quality. First, try to sit closer to the center of the car or near the windows. The metal body of the train shields the signal, and sitting near the window minimizes signal loss as it passes through the car's casing.
Second, use range 5 GHz, if your device and train equipment support this standard. It's less noisy than the 2.4 GHz frequency and provides higher data transfer rates, although it has a shorter range. In train conditions, where the signal source is located within a single car, this advantage becomes decisive.
Third, close background apps that consume data. App updates, photo syncing to the cloud, and auto-uploading videos on social media can silently eat up your high-speed data allowance. Configure your operating system to disable background data transfers on Wi-Fi networks with limited access.

Why might Wi-Fi not work in Lastochka tunnels?
In tunnels and on closed sections of track, the signal from ground-based cell phone towers physically doesn't reach. Train equipment doesn't have its own satellite internet connection (with the exception of some premium long-distance trains), so at such times, the connection is completely lost until the train reaches open ground.
Is it safe to enter card details into Lastochka's Wi-Fi?
Payment gateway provider MT_Free uses a secure connection SSL/TLSHowever, the general security recommendation for public networks is to avoid entering bank card details if there's no lock icon in the browser or the certificate is questionable. It's better to pay for your plan through the operator's official app or from your mobile phone balance.
Is it possible to share Wi-Fi from a phone connected to Lastochka?
Technically, this is possible, but is often blocked at the provider server level. The system detects multiple connections from the same MAC address or a TTL different from the mobile device's and may limit speed or block access. Furthermore, this creates a double load on the channel, which will degrade connection quality for everyone.
What should I do if I don't receive an SMS with a code?
Check your SIM card balance, cellular network coverage (not Wi-Fi), and whether the message memory is full. The code may also be delayed due to operator gateway congestion. Try requesting the code again in 2-3 minutes or use an alternative authorization method if offered on the login page.
Does Lastochka's Wi-Fi work abroad (for example, in Finland)?
Service availability may vary on international routes. In some cases, roaming partners do not support free authorization, and access may be unavailable or charged at international rates. Always check the terms on board or on the Russian Railways website before traveling.
